IDOC_INBOUND_ASYNCHRONUS - Alternate idoc fails

0 Kudos

Hi All,

MII Version 15.3 SP0

I am facing a strange issue while sending IDocs from SAP to MII system. All the alternate Idocs are failing, I mean to say one will be success and next one fails , again 3rd is success and 4th fails. The error (attached screenshot) is common one we see at SM58 tcode as well as in Netweaver log. I wonder why only alternate idocs are getting failed.

Error Message.

java.lang.RuntimeException: Bean IDOC_INBOUND_ASYNCHRONOUS not found on host xxxxx, ProgId=XMIIIDOC01: Object not found in lookup of IDOC_INBOUND_ASYNCHRONOUS
